The phone will be both too small and too low down to use 'safely'.

The din unit is too large unless you do a full consol running down into the footwell and back to the rear bulkhead.

The mimic system looks like it would do all you need. I've not looked at the spec but cannot believe they would not have included a remote mic facility.

Why not just hide the A/C controls under the dash...they are nothing to look at and only you need to use them so they do not need to be on view.

From a syling point of view, and I don't claim to be a stylist in any shape or form, IMHO you should have a full front to back centre consol or nothing at all. The current drop down just looks wrong which I suspect is why you are struggling with it.

I assume the top will be leather and below the line carpet.
In which case you may want to mould in a slot below the line so your trimmer can sew the leather to the carpet then loose the sewn edge into the slot.
